Nurturing Life Sciences
#Id: 6284
Mechanism: How Polymerase Find Promoter Sequences
#Id: 5666
#Unit 7. System Physiology – Animal
#Id: 5667
#Id: 5668
#Id: 5669
#Id: 5670
#Id: 5671